Contractor facing charges of swindling elderly couple of $789,000
Officials say the remodeler charged almost $800,000 for work that should have cost between $40,000 and $150,000.
Joy Powell, Star Tribune

A Twin Cities-area building contractor was charged Tuesday with swindling an elderly Minneapolis couple out of more than $789,000 for remodeling work that authorities say has left them with many code violations and a structurally unsound home.
Richard D. Gurewitz, owner of Home Update Co., performed work that should have cost between $40,000 and $150,000, according to a criminal complaint filed Tuesday in Hennepin County District Court charging him with five counts of theft by swindle.

"Justice won out, and I want to thank everyone who put all this effort into making it come to a head," Betty Caverly, 81, said Tuesday night.

Hennepin County sheriff's investigators arrested Gurewitz on Monday at his Plymouth townhouse, and he remained in jail Tuesday night in lieu of $100,000 bail. Detective George Bergin called the case "appalling."

The charges say Gurewitz told Betty and Gerald Caverly, 78, that they would need to spend $800,000 on several remodeling projects -- yet he has been able to account for only $80,000 of the money spent by his company.

Betty Caverly had hired Home Update, then of Minnetonka, to renovate her century-old home, which has a market value of $102,000. The bid included replacing ceilings and wallboard, upgrading electrical wiring and plumbing and other remodeling of the 640-square-foot house in the Longfellow neighborhood.

Gurewitz grossly inflated prices and misrepresented the scope of his work, authorities said. Bank records show that during the remodeling, from July 2003 to July 2005, about $420,000 of the Caverlys' money was funneled to Gurewitz, his parents and sister. Home Update accounts were used to pay NWA World Vacations $16,450, and the Minnesota Timberwolves/Lynx nearly $9,400, the complaint said.

During the two-year project, Betty Caverly cared for her husband, who has Alzheimer's disease, and tried to keep up with invoices, changes in the work and Home Update's demand for checks, she said. Early on, Gurewitz claimed he had lost the job paperwork and needed hers to make copies, then never returned her 20 or so pages, she said.

Last August, when her inheritance was drained, Betty turned to her son, Gordon, for another $31,000 to finish remodeling her 5-by-6-foot bathroom. He halted the project.

The Caverlys are left with ripped-out walls, code violations and structural hazards in the worst case that state investigators have ever seen, said Charlie Durenberger, head of investigations for the Minnesota Department of Labor and Industry.

Bergin, the sheriff's investigator, said that as he and another detective, Brian McKague, plowed through reams of paperwork, their outrage grew.

"Once we went to interview the Caverlys in their home, then you're just appalled by the condition of that house," Bergin said. "You realize they don't have to be living how they're living. They don't even have a functioning bathroom in that house to date, and they spent almost $800,000."

Betty Caverly told investigators that she had no idea how much remodeling projects cost and she didn't realize that she given Home Update more than $750,000 by the summer of 2005.

Gurewitz had owned and operated remodeling businesses under various names since 1990, drawing more than 22 complaints over the years.
